Subject: [PATCH nf v2] netfilter: nf_tables: fix destination register zeroing

Following bug was reported via irc:
nft list ruleset
set knock_candidates_ipv4 {
type ipv4_addr . inet_service
size 65535
elements = { 127.0.0.1 . 123,
127.0.0.1 . 123 }
}
..
udp dport 123 add @knock_candidates_ipv4 { ip saddr . 123 }
udp dport 123 add @knock_candidates_ipv4 { ip saddr . udp dport }
It should not have been possible to add a duplicate set entry.
After some debugging it turned out that the problem is the immediate
value (123) in the second-to-last rule.
Concatenations use 32bit registers, i.e. the elements are 8 bytes each,
not 6 and it turns out the kernel inserted
inet firewall @knock_candidates_ipv4
element 0100007f ffff7b00 : 0 [end]
element 0100007f 00007b00 : 0 [end]
Note the non-zero upper bits of the first element. It turns out that
nft_immediate doesn't zero the destination register, but this is needed
when the length isn't a multiple of 4.
Furthermore, the zeroing in nft_payload is broken. We can't use
[len / 4] = 0 -- if len is a multiple of 4, index is off by one.
Skip zeroing in this case and use a conditional instead of (len -1) / 4.

diff --git a/include/net/netfilter/nf_tables.h b/include/net/netfilter/nf_tables.h
index bf9491b77d16..224d194ad29d 100644
--- a/include/net/netfilter/nf_tables.h
+++ b/include/net/netfilter/nf_tables.h
@@ -143,6 +143,8 @@ static inline u64 nft_reg_load64(const u32 *sreg)
static inline void nft_data_copy(u32 *dst, const struct nft_data *src,
unsigned int len)
{
+ if (len % NFT_REG32_SIZE)
+ dst[len / NFT_REG32_SIZE] = 0;
memcpy(dst, src, len);
}
diff --git a/net/netfilter/nft_payload.c b/net/netfilter/nft_payload.c
index ed7cb9f747f6..7a2e59638499 100644
--- a/net/netfilter/nft_payload.c
+++ b/net/netfilter/nft_payload.c
@@ -87,7 +87,9 @@ void nft_payload_eval(const struct nft_expr *expr,
u32 *dest = ®s->data[priv->dreg];
int offset;
- dest[priv->len / NFT_REG32_SIZE] = 0;
+ if (priv->len % NFT_REG32_SIZE)
+ dest[priv->len / NFT_REG32_SIZE] = 0;
+
switch (priv->base) {
case NFT_PAYLOAD_LL_HEADER:
if (!skb_mac_header_was_set(skb))
